diff --git a/README.md b/README.md index e269b10..d2706f3 100644 --- a/README.md +++ b/README.md @@ -422,7 +422,8 @@ await sock.sendMessage( { video: "./Media/ma_gif.mp4", caption: "hello!", - gifPlayback: true + gifPlayback: true, + ptv: false // if set to true, will send as a `video note` } ) diff --git a/src/Utils/messages.ts b/src/Utils/messages.ts index 0ec8782..178e427 100644 --- a/src/Utils/messages.ts +++ b/src/Utils/messages.ts @@ -413,6 +413,12 @@ export const generateWAMessageContent = async( } break } + } else if('ptv' in message) { + const { videoMessage } = await prepareWAMessageMedia( + { video: message.video }, + options + ) + m.ptvMessage = videoMessage } else if('product' in message) { const { imageMessage } = await prepareWAMessageMedia( { image: message.product.productImage },